Davids warns against warm-up mentality as Springboks prepare for Buenos Aires test
Springbok assistant coach Deon Davids has rejected suggestions that Saturday's Test in Buenos Aires is a warm-up for the All Blacks series, warning that approaching Argentina on home soil with that mindset would be a serious mistake, as returning stars including Kolisi, Etzebeth and Feinberg-Mngomezulu are set to feature against a Pumas side fielding 10 uncapped players.
Blitzboks to defend SVNS title as 2026/27 schedule confirmed with Cape Town return
World Rugby has confirmed the 2026/27 HSBC SVNS schedule, with Cape Town Stadium hosting on 5-6 December and the Blitzboks returning as defending Series and World Champions to lead an eight-team men's field.
Erasmus eyes Argentina match as injury-return audition ahead of All Blacks series
Erasmus will name his Argentina touring squad on Saturday, with the Buenos Aires Test doubling as a fitness audition for the RGR series against New Zealand. Only Nche and Mostert are unavailable, while ten players return from injury in time to be considered.
Boks remain top but All Blacks close gap to 2.90 points after Nations Championship opener
South Africa stay top of the World Rugby Men's Rankings at 93.94 points but New Zealand have cut the gap to 2.90 after beating France, while Scotland climb to equal their all-time high of fifth following a record 47-38 win over Argentina in Córdoba.
Blitzboks bounce back with 26-5 win over Kenya at Bordeaux Sevens
Shilton van Wyk and Quewin Nortje scored two tries each as the Blitzboks beat Kenya 26-5 at the Bordeaux Sevens, setting up a must-win clash with Fiji on Saturday.
